In the realm of traditional medicine, one herb that draws interest for its potential to invigorate blood health is Rehmannia Glutinosa.

Extracted from the root of the rehmannia plant, this magnificent herb is frequently utilized in regions of East Asia, particularly within China, where it has been used for mankind's history for its beneficial properties. Valued as a wonderful natural remedy for enhancing blood health, it offers a great array of medicinal effects that transcend its primary use.

The plant, is often discussed in the sphere of the good it brings to blood health, as it is known to help enhance one's blood circulation and vitality. With its vast range of benefits, the rehmannia benefits include a potential improvement of heart health, enhancement of kidney function, and a lowering in nebulous symptoms of fatigue.

Frequently added in herbal blood tonics, this amazing plant offers many wellness benefits, featuring being a high source of crucial nutrients and antioxidants.
